WebAug 6, 2006 · ears – space at the top of the front page on each side of the newspaper’s name where weather news, index to pages or announcement of special features appears . edition – a press run of a newspaper. A daily generally has more than one edition a day – for example, “City Edition”, “Lakeshore Edition”, “Early Edition”, “Late ...
